Lakenvelder chickens are a Dutch breed of chicken that is known for its aggression towards other animals. Lakenvelders have been known to kill smaller animals, such as rodents and reptiles. They can also be aggressive towards other chickens, sometimes even killing them. Lakenvelder chickens are also known for being quite noisy.

The Asil or Aseel is an Indian breed or group of breeds of game chicken.It is distributed in much of India, particularly in the states of Tamil Nadu, Andhra Pradesh, Chhattisgarh and Odisha; it has been exported to several other countries. Similar fowl are found throughout much of Southeast Asia. 3. Ayam Cemani. The Ayam Cemani is a very rare native Indonesian breed. This bird is black inside and out. Yup, even on the inside. Their organs, meat, and bones are black. Even this dual-purpose chicken breed has dark red blood. On the outside, everything from the tip of their comb to the nails on their toes is black.
